New product and how to use it.

On last night’s Facebook Live I showcased the new Show What You Love Suite.  While I hopefully captured some of the textures and colors in the video nothing replaces seeing it in real life.  If you would like to take a look before determining if you want to order it please contact me.  It’s worth a look in real life.

But for now we will sit here with photos of the cards I created last night.

20180419_090353_wm.jpg

The technique on the left is called the kissing technique.  This is done by inking a background or more solid stamp.  Then you take whatever detail you want to highlight and stamp that in to the already inked background stamp.  Then stamp as normal.

Window sheets for a box.

Window sheets are not just for shaker cards.  They can also be used for an entire pouch.  Instead of using cardstock try using a piece of window sheet.  Just make sure to have matching or complementary shreds to go inside.  They can be so cute with the right contents to match. So next time you buy a gift or some candy make sure to match your ribbon or tag too.
